     The instructions set forth in this Letter of Transmittal (the "Letter of
Transmittal") should be read carefully before this Letter of Transmittal is
completed. The undersigned acknowledges that he or she has received and reviewed
the Prospectus, dated , 2004 (the "Prospectus"), of Suburban Propane Partners,
L.P., a Delaware limited partnership and Suburban Energy Finance Corp., a
Delaware corporation (together, the "Issuers") and this Letter of Transmittal,
which together constitute the Issuers' offer (the "Exchange Offer") to exchange
up to $175,000,000 aggregate principal amount of the Issuers' 6 7/8% Senior
Notes due 2013 (the "Exchange Notes"), which have been registered under the
Securities Act of 1933, as amended (the "Securities Act"), for a like principal
amount of the Issuers' issued and outstanding 6 7/8% Senior Notes due 2013 (the
"Outstanding Notes"), which have not been so registered. The Bank of New York
(the "Exchange Agent") has been appointed as exchange agent for the Exchange
Offer.

     For each Outstanding Note accepted for exchange, the registered holder of
such Outstanding Note (collectively with all other registered holders of
Outstanding Notes, the "Holders") will receive an Exchange Note having a
principal amount equal to that of the surrendered Outstanding Note. Registered
holders of Exchange Notes on the record date for the first interest payment date
following the consummation of the Exchange Offer will receive interest accruing
from the most recent date to which interest has been paid. Outstanding Notes
accepted for exchange will cease to accrue interest from and after the date of
consummation of the Exchange Offer. Accordingly, Holders whose Outstanding Notes
are accepted for exchange will not receive any payment in respect of accrued
interest on such Outstanding Notes otherwise payable on any interest payment
date after consummation of the Exchange Offer and, in lieu thereof, will receive
payment with respect to accrued interest on the Exchange Notes to the extent
Outstanding Notes or Exchange Notes were held on the applicable record date.

     This Letter of Transmittal is to be completed by a Holder of Outstanding
Notes either if Outstanding Notes are to be forwarded herewith or if a tender of
Outstanding Notes, if available, is to be made by book-entry transfer to





the account maintained by the Exchange Agent at The Depository Trust Company
(the "DTC") pursuant to the procedures set forth in "The Exchange
Offer--Procedures for Tendering Outstanding Notes" section of the Prospectus.
Holders of Outstanding Notes whose certificates are not immediately available,
or who are unable to deliver their certificates or confirmation of the
book-entry tender of their Outstanding Notes into the Exchange Agent's account
at DTC (a "Book-Entry Confirmation") and all other documents required by this
Letter of Transmittal to the Exchange Agent on or prior to the Expiration Date,
must tender their Outstanding Notes according to the guaranteed delivery
procedures set forth in "The Exchange Offer--Guaranteed Delivery Procedures"
section of the Prospectus. See Instruction 1. Delivery of documents to DTC does
not constitute delivery to the Exchange Agent.

1.   Delivery Of This Letter Of Trasmittal And Outstanding Notes; Guaranteed
     Delivery Procedures.

     This Letter of Transmittal is to be completed by Holders of Outstanding
Notes either if certificates are to be forwarded herewith or if tenders are to
be made pursuant to the procedures for delivery by book-entry transfer set forth
in "The Exchange Offer--Procedures for Tendering Outstanding Notes" section of
the Prospectus and an Agent's Message is not delivered. Certificates for all
physically tendered Outstanding Notes, or Book-Entry Confirmation, as the case
may be, as well as a properly completed and duly executed Letter of Transmittal
(or a manually signed facsimile hereof) and any other documents required by this
Letter of Transmittal, must be received by the Exchange Agent at the address set
forth herein on or prior to the Expiration Date, or the tendering Holder must
comply with the guaranteed delivery procedures set forth below. Outstanding
Notes tendered hereby must be in denominations of principal amount of $1,000 and
any integral multiple thereof. The term "Agent's Message" means a message
transmitted by DTC to, and received by, the Exchange Agent and forming a part of
the Book-Entry Confirmation, which states that DTC has received an express
acknowledgment from the DTC participant tendering through ATOP that such DTC
participant has received this Letter of Transmittal and agrees to be bound by
the terms of this Letter of Transmittal and that the Issuers may enforce the
Letter of Transmittal against such DTC participant. Holders who tender their
Outstanding Notes using the DTC ATOP procedures need not submit this Letter of
Transmittal.

     Holders whose certificates for Outstanding Notes are not immediately
available or who cannot deliver their certificates and all other required
documents to the Exchange Agent on or prior to the Expiration Date, or who
cannot complete the procedure for book-entry transfer on a timely basis, may
tender their Outstanding Notes pursuant to the guaranteed delivery procedures
set forth in "The Exchange Offer--Guaranteed Delivery Procedures" section of the
Prospectus. Pursuant to such procedures, (i) such tender must be made through an
Eligible Institution (as defined in Instruction 3), (ii) on or prior to 5:00
p.m., New York City time, on the Expiration Date, the Exchange Agent must
receive from such Eligible Institution a properly completed and duly executed
Notice of Guaranteed Delivery, substantially in the form provided by the Issuers
(by facsimile transmission, overnight delivery mail or hand delivery), setting
forth the name and address of the Holder of Outstanding Notes and the amount of
Outstanding Notes tendered, stating that the tender is being made thereby and
guaranteeing that within three Business Days after the Expiration Date, a
properly completed and executed Letter of Transmittal or Agent's Message, as the
case may be, the certificates for all physically tendered Outstanding Notes, in
proper form for transfer, or a Book-Entry Confirmation, as the case may be, and
any other documents required by this Letter of Transmittal will be deposited by
the Eligible Institution with the Exchange Agent, and (iii) a properly completed
and executed Letter of Transmittal or Agent's Message, as the case may be, the
certificates for all physically tendered Outstanding Notes, in proper form for
transfer, or Book-Entry Confirmation, as the case may be, and any other
documents required by this Letter of Transmittal, are deposited by the Eligible
Institution within three Business Days after the Expiration Date. The term
"Business Day" means any day that is not a Saturday, Sunday or legal Holiday in
New York, New York and on which commercial banks are open for business in New
York, New York.

     The method of delivery of this Letter of Transmittal, the Outstanding Notes
and all other required documents is at the election and risk of the tendering
Holders, but delivery will be deemed made only upon actual receipt or
confirmation by the Exchange Agent. If Outstanding Notes are sent by mail, it is
suggested that the mailing be registered mail, properly insured, with return
receipt requested, and made sufficiently in advance of the Expiration Date to
permit delivery to the Exchange Agent prior to 5:00 p.m., New York City time, on
the Expiration Date.

                            IMPORTANT TAX INFORMATION

     Under current United States federal income tax law, a prospective Holder of
Exchange Notes to be issued pursuant to the "Special Issuance Instructions" (as
described above) may be subject to backup withholding tax unless such
prospective Holder provides the Issuers (as payors), through the Exchange Agent,
with Substitute Form W-9, as described below in "Purpose of Substitute Form
W-9," or otherwise establishes a basis for exemption. Accordingly, each
prospective Holder of Exchange Notes to be issued pursuant to Special Issuance
Instructions should complete the attached Substitute Form W-9. The Substitute
Form W-9 need not be completed if the box entitled Special Issuance Instructions
has not been completed.

     Certain Holders of Exchange Notes (including, among others, all
corporations and certain foreign persons) are not subject to these backup
withholding tax and reporting requirements. Exempt prospective Holders of
Exchange Notes should indicate their exempt status on Substitute Form W-9. A
foreign person may qualify as an exempt recipient by submitting to the Issuers,
through the Exchange Agent, a properly completed Internal Revenue Service Form
W-8 (which the Exchange Agent will provide upon request) signed under penalty of
perjury, attesting to the Holder's exempt status. See the enclosed Guidelines
for Certification of Taxpayer Identification Number on Substitute Form W-9 for
additional instructions.

     If backup withholding tax applies, the Issuers are required to withhold 28%
(31% after 2010) of any payment made to the Holder of Exchange Notes or other
payee. Backup withholding tax is not an additional United States federal income
tax. Rather, the United States federal income tax liability of persons subject
to backup withholding tax will be reduced by the amount of tax withheld. If
withholding results in an overpayment of taxes, a refund may be obtained from
the Internal Revenue Service.

PURPOSE OF SUBSTITUTE FORM W-9

     To prevent backup withholding tax on any Exchange Notes delivered pursuant
to the Exchange Offer and any payments received in respect of the Exchange
Notes, each prospective Holder of Exchange Notes to be issued pursuant to
Special Issuance Instructions should provide the Issuers, through the Exchange
Agent, with either: (i) (a) such prospective Holder's correct TIN (e.g., social
security number or employer identification number) on Substitute Form W-9
attached hereto, certifying that the TIN provided on Substitute Form W-9 is
correct (or that such prospective Holder has applied for and is awaiting a TIN);
(b) certification that (1) such prospective Holder has not been notified by the
Internal Revenue Service that he or she is subject to backup withholding tax as
a result of a failure to report all interest or dividends or (2) the Internal
Revenue Service has notified such prospective Holder that he or she is no longer
subject to backup withholding tax; and (c) certification that the Holder is a
United States person; or (ii) an adequate basis for exemption from backup
withholding tax. If such Holder is an individual, the TIN is such Holder's
social security number. If the Exchange Agent is not provided with the correct
TIN, the Holder of the Exchange Notes may be subject to certain penalties
imposed by the Internal Revenue Service unless such failure is due to reasonable
cause and not to willful neglect.
